Robert W. Blake is a scholar working on Aerospace Engineering, Nature and Landscape Conservation and Genetics. According to data from OpenAlex, Robert W. Blake has authored 203 papers receiving a total of 6.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 55 papers in Aerospace Engineering, 51 papers in Nature and Landscape Conservation and 51 papers in Genetics. Recurrent topics in Robert W. Blake's work include Biomimetic flight and propulsion mechanisms (53 papers),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(46 papers) and Fish Ecology and Management Studies (43 papers). Robert W. Blake is often cited by papers focused on Biomimetic flight and propulsion mechanisms (53 papers),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(46 papers) and Fish Ecology and Management Studies (43 papers). Robert W. Blake coll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and Mexico. Robert W. Blake's co-authors include Paolo Domenici, David G. Harper, B. Ahlborn, P.A. Oltenacu, James Lighthill, Charles F. Nicholson, R.L. Quaas, Julianna M. Gál, C. Richard Shumway and David R. Jones and has published in prestigious journals such as Bioinformatics, Journal of Fluid Mechanics and British Journal of Pharmacology.
